How to reunite with your children after CPS removes them from your home?

When CPS removes a child from their home, the reunification process requires compliance with a series of requirements that may include psychological evaluations, parenting programs, drug testing, and supervised visitation.

Although it is a difficult path, parents have the right to work toward reunification. Having a family law attorney is key to guide you through each step and demonstrate to the court that the home is safe and stable for the child.
